WiMAX, WiBro Measurements – Programming Examples
(Options K92/93)
The following section provides some examples of commonly performed operations when using the
WiMAX IEEE 802.16 OFDM, OFDMA Measurements option (R&S FSL–K93). For more general remote
control examples refer to the other programming examples in this chapter.
The WiMAX IEEE 802.16 OFDM, OFDMA Measurements option (R&S FSL–K93) includes the
functionality of the WiMAX 802.16 OFDM Measurements option (R&S FSL–K92). Accordingly both
options are described together in this section. The options are available from firmware version 1.40
(R&S FSL–K92) and 1.50 (R&S FSL–K93).
Synchronization Entry of Option
The following example shows how to synchronize entering the WiMAX IEEE 802.16 OFDM, OFDMA
Measurements option.
analyzer = 20 'Instrument address
CALL InstrWrite(analyzer, "INST:SEL WLAN;*OPC?")
'waits for 1 from *OPC?
Selecting Measurements
Measurements are selected using the command CONFigure:BURSt:<Meas Type> where <Meas
Type> is as follows:
<Meas Type> Measurement Type
PVT Power vs Time (PVT)
PVT:SELect EDGE PVT Start and End (OFDM)
PVT Rsing / Falling (OFDMA & WiBro)
PVT:SELect FULL PVT Full Burst (OFDM)
PVT Full Subframe (OFDMA & WiBro)
EVM:ECARrier EVM vs Carrier
EVM:ESYMbol EVM vs Symbol
SPECtrum:MASK Spectrum Mask
SPECtrum:MASK:SELect IEEE Spectrum Mask IEEE
SPECtrum:MASK:SELect ETSI Spectrum Mask ETSI
SPECtrum:FLATness Spectrum Flatness
SPECtrum:FLATness:SELect FLATNESS Spectrum Flatness
SPECtrum:FLATness:SELect GRDELAY Spectrum Flatness – Group Delay
SPECtrum:FLATness:SELect DIFFERENCE Spectrum Flatness – Difference
SPECtrum:FFT Spectrum FFT
